- adjectivefunny (adjective) · funnier (comparative adjective) · funniest (superlative adjective)
- causing laughter or amusement; humorous:"a funny story" · "the play is hilariously funny"
- informalused to emphasize that something is serious or should be taken seriously:"stealing other people's work isn't funny"
- difficult to explain or understand; strange or odd:"I had a funny feeling you'd be around" · "the funny thing is I can't remember much about it" · "that's funny!—that vase of flowers has been moved"
- unusual, especially in such a way as to arouse suspicion:"there was something funny going on"
- informalslightly but undefinably unwell:"suddenly my stomach felt funny" · "Are you okay? You look a bit funny"
nounfunnies (plural noun) · funny (noun)- NORTH AMERICAN ENGLISH(funnies)comic strips in newspapers:"I read the sports page, funnies, and editorial"
- informala joke or witty remark:"I was trying to make a funny, but failed miserably" · "he regaled his hosts with a few funnies"
